OLD ROUND ROCK CEMETERY
CLEAN-UP PROJECT












Round Rock Preservation partnered with the Round Rock Cemetery Association on Saturday, October 28, 2017, from 9 a.m. to noon, to clean up the Old Round Rock Cemetery, located on Sam Bass Road (1/2 mile west of I-35). Frank Darr, chaired the project, along with Larry Quick (a member of RR Cemetery Association and RR Preservation).  Other committee members were  Rae Lynn Tipping, Tina Steiner, & Ann Darr.
 
Forty-nine volunteers from the community and Round Rock Preservation helped accomplish this project.  The City of Round Rock provided lawn maintenance tools from their Tool Lending Truck.  Volunteers were organized into several small groups to accomplish needed cleanup actions. Trucks with trailers hauled off the bush to the City's recycling center.
